What's The Definition Of Postillate?Synonyms | Synonyms for Postillate: Related Terms | Find terms related to Postillate: See Also | Postillate In Webster's Dictionary \Pos"til*late\, v. t. [LL. postillatus, p. p. of
postillare.]
To explain by marginal notes; to postil.
Tracts . . . postillated by his own hand. --C. Knight.
\Pos"til*late\, v. i. 1. To write postils; to comment. 2. To preach by expounding Scripture verse by verse, in regular order. |
